7-inch Asus Transformer in the pipeline?

We don’t bring up tablets like the one you see in the picture above very often, since they all have 10-inch screens. But every time that we do, it’s usually to tell you that the manufacturers of those aforementioned large tablets have seen the error of their ways and have decided to start producing more pocketable 7-inch varieties.

Thankfully, that’s what Asus has allegedly decided to do with its Transformer tablet.

According to a new report from today, the Taiwanese company is going to unleash a plethora of Android tablets next year, one of which is expected to be a 7-inch Transformer. Combined with its laptop dock and some other accessories, the smaller Transformer could be a serious contender for the mobile business professional who needs to pack light and do serious work.

On the contrary, though, a smaller screen for its dock would translate to a smaller keyboard. Still, I think a 7-inch Transformer could enter a niche market . . . and possibly my house.
